]> git.karo-electronics.de Git - mv-sheeva.git/commitdiff
perf kvm: Get rid of unused guest_kallsyms
authorGui Jianfeng <guijianfeng@cn.fujitsu.com>
Fri, 25 Jun 2010 02:15:28 +0000 (10:15 +0800)
committerArnaldo Carvalho de Melo <acme@redhat.com>
Fri, 25 Jun 2010 10:28:21 +0000 (07:28 -0300)
guest_kallsyms is redundant here, remove it.

Cc: Ingo Molnar <mingo@elte.hu>
Cc: Peter Zijlstra <a.p.zijlstra@chello.nl>
Cc: Yanmin Zhang <yanmin_zhang@linux.intel.com>
LKML-Reference: <4C241140.9090008@cn.fujitsu.com>
Signed-off-by: Gui Jianfeng <guijianfeng@cn.fujitsu.com>
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>
tools/perf/builtin-record.c

index 86b1c3b6264e71790b4113a1a50a1654abcdbcfd..0df64088135fc47d580448ea199723f159a6db79 100644 (file)
@@ -445,8 +445,6 @@ static void atexit_header(void)
 static void event__synthesize_guest_os(struct machine *machine, void *data)
 {
        int err;
-       char *guest_kallsyms;
-       char path[PATH_MAX];
        struct perf_session *psession = data;
 
        if (machine__is_host(machine))
@@ -466,13 +464,6 @@ static void event__synthesize_guest_os(struct machine *machine, void *data)
                pr_err("Couldn't record guest kernel [%d]'s reference"
                       " relocation symbol.\n", machine->pid);
 
-       if (machine__is_default_guest(machine))
-               guest_kallsyms = (char *) symbol_conf.default_guest_kallsyms;
-       else {
-               sprintf(path, "%s/proc/kallsyms", machine->root_dir);
-               guest_kallsyms = path;
-       }
-
        /*
         * We use _stext for guest kernel because guest kernel's /proc/kallsyms
         * have no _text sometimes.